Be aware of what you can give

Before looking for locations to donate your furniture, you need for you to take a look at the furniture which you currently own. Most donation locations take furniture presentable and in good condition. It is important that furniture be clean of any major damages staining, smells or spills. Furniture that is damaged poorly, broken, or used may not get a good deal since they can't be widely sold or used by other people.

Bloomington ReStore It's a Favorite Choice

One option that is popular to consider in Bloomington is Bloomington ReStore. Bloomington ReStore, controlled by Habitat for Humanity. This nonprofit home improvement store and donation center will accept donations of both gently second hand furniture, appliances tools for building, household items and more. All proceeds from donations will be used to help Habitat provide affordable housing to low-income families.
